LEONA Botanical Café & Bar — an urban garden + restaurant from the teams behind Veracruz All Natural and DEE DEE — opens on Tuesday, Nov. 11.
It sits on a five-acre site turned nature habitat where you’ll find a cafe and bar, mini versions of Veracruz and DEE DEE, and an upcoming Bun Bun Burger collaborative concept from both restaurants.

Opening
Tancho Sushi + Sake will debut a second location in central Austin’s Rosedale area on Wednesday, Nov. 12. The restaurant, which is known for its “omakase for everyone” ranging from $29 to $59, will seat 75 people at its new location. (CultureMap)
Traffic
Next time you’re sitting in traffic, think about this: Roadway congestion has yet to return to pre-pandemic levels, according to the 2025 Urban Mobility Report. Traffic is still about 10% lower when compared to 2019, but it’s getting worse. Traffic increased by ~6% from 2023 to 2024. (Austin Business Journal)

Travel
Viva Aerobus’s planned route between Austin and Mexico City, which was slated to begin later this month, will no longer be able to launch. The cancellation is a result of an order from the U.S. Transportation Secretary stating that Mexican airlines can’t carry both passengers and cargo at once. (KXAN)
State
If you have old tech collecting dust around the house, the Texas Archive of the Moving Image wants it. TAMI put out an “Equipment Round-Up” call yesterday, asking for VCRs, 1-inch decks, hard drives, and more to help preserve its footage. (KXAN)
